About the role

Responsibilities

GBTO provides the most reliable, flexible and efficient Risk & Finance platform and delivers the shared market data repository for our partners in MARK, RISQ & DFIN to:

Meet the strategic business needs of GBIS.

Meet our regulatory commitments and secure the provision of reports to regulators.

Optimize capital requirements.

Distribute certified data.

Manage and ensure the consistency of the PNL, Market, Liquidity and Credit Risks, and Accounting and Finance for the Bank

Contribute to the digital transformation of GBIS.

GBTO/PRE/CFI provides Fixed Income market risk calculators to our partners on Rates and FX. X-ONE / Riskone is a key application where pricing curves definition are used to project the risk in the calculators. You will work on highly visible and business‑critical systems that price financial products, distribute real‑time market data, and support trading activities in a demanding environment characterized by performance, low latency, and reliability constraints.

This role combines feature development, test framework engineering and L3 support critical to delivering robust, high‑quality pricing and reliable solutions.

Your Responsibilities

Design and develop pricing features aligned with business and technical roadmaps

Participate in modernization initiatives, including .NET to .NET Core transformations

Contribute to performance‑critical and low‑latency system components

Participating in key strategic projects to support the business and the bank ambition

Design, refactor, and optimize automated test frameworks to ensure

Functional coverage of pricing feature

Improved stability and execution performance

Adoption of testing best practices

Develop and maintain unit and non‑regression tests

Collaborate closely with Traders, Sales, and IT teams across the pricing chain

Work on a large‑scale codebase

Participating in production activities and application support

Profile required

Competencies required

Strong experience in C# / .NET / .NET Core

Solid understanding of software design, testing, and performance optimization

Knowledge in Finance, especially market risks process and fixed income products

Ability to work with tight deadlines

Organized, autonomous, and collaborative, with a strong sense of ownership

Collaboration and team spirit

Master’s degree in computer science, engineering, or equivalent job experience

Technical Environment

C#, .NET, .NET Core

REST APIs

CI/CD pipelines

GitHub, Jenkins, JIRA

Sonar

MongoDB, MySQL

RabbitMQ

Elasticsearch & Kibana

High performance and low latency systems

AI tools

Prior work experience required:

At least 2 years of Market Risk and PnL experience at a large bank or Insurance

At least 3 years of experience as a developer
